प्रश्न
Form the differential equation of all the lines which are normal to the line 3x + 2y + 7 = 0.
Advertisements
उत्तर
Slope of the line 3x - 2y + 7 = 0 is `(- 3)/-2 = 3/2`
∴ slope of normal to this line is `- 2/3`
Then the equation of the normal is
y = `- 2/3 "x" + "k"`, where k is an arbitrary constant.
Differentiating w.r.t. x, we get
`"dy"/"dx" = - 2/3 xx 1 + 0`
∴ `3"dy"/"dx" + 2 = 0`
This is the required D.E.
